Police Seize 6,000 Rolls of Bhang in Mariakani Trailer Bust

MARIAKANI: Police in Mariakani have intercepted a trailer transporting 6,000 rolls of cannabis sativa, following an intelligence-led operation along the Mariakani–Mazeras Road on Saturday, August 16, 2025.

According to the National Police Service (NPS), officers who stopped and searched the vehicle discovered six sacks stuffed with the rolls of bhang.

The trailer’s driver was immediately arrested and taken to the Coast Regional Police Headquarters for processing, pending arraignment in court.

In a statement, NPS commended members of the public for providing the crucial tip-off that enabled the successful operation.
